About 43a

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

43a is a five-bedroom detached house in Colehill, Wimborne, Wimborne (BH21 2RR). It has a recorded floor area of 253 m² (around 2723 sq ft) and council tax band G. The latest certificate (June 2020) shows a C (score 75), near the top of the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since May 2012. Between certificates, window ef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and hot-water efficiency dropped from Average to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 83). Main heating runs on electricity.

At 253 m² the property is well over the postcode median (148 m² across 12 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Last changed hands 10 years ago, in February 2016. Across 2013–2016, sale prices on this property compounded at 10.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£992,000 is 18.8% above the 2016 sale price.
